Cohesin/HP1γ binding, H3K9me3, and DNA methylation are intact on non-4q/10q D4Z4 homologs in FSHD1 and FSHD2 cells. A: ChIP-qPCR analysis using antibodies specific for H3K9me3, H3K27me3, and methylcytidine (metC) using 4q/10q-specific (4q/10q-Q-PCR) and non-4q/10q-specific (Q-PCR-F + chr 3-R, chr 15-F + 4q-Hox-R, Q-PCR-F + chr 22-R) PCR primers as indicated at the top. Four normal control (white bars), six FSHD1 (grey bars), and one FSHD2 (black bar) myoblast samples were analyzed. The quantitative real-time PCR was normalized with input DNA and preimmune controls as indicated. P-values for significant differences between normal and FSHD samples are indicated. B: ChIP-qPCR analysis of cohesin and HP1γ in control and FSHD1 myoblasts. C: ChIP-qPCR analysis of normal control and FSHD2 fibroblasts using antibodies specific for H3K9me3, H3K27me3, cohesin, HP1γ, and met-C as indicated.
